How does the root structure of companion plants affect weed growth?

Companion planting is an age-old gardening technique that involves growing different plants together to enhance growth and deter pests. One of the lesser-known benefits of companion planting is its ability to control weed growth through the interaction of root structures.

How Do Root Structures of Companion Plants Affect Weed Growth?

The root structures of companion plants can significantly impact weed growth by competing for nutrients, water, and space. This competition can suppress weed growth, making it an effective natural weed management strategy. Additionally, some companion plants release chemicals through their roots that inhibit weed germination and growth, a process known as allelopathy.

Which Companion Plants Are Effective for Weed Management?

1. Clover

Clover is a popular companion plant known for its dense root system that covers the ground effectively, reducing the area available for weeds to establish. It also fixes nitrogen, enriching the soil for neighboring plants.

2. Marigold

Marigolds are not only beautiful but also practical. Their roots exude substances that deter nematodes, and their dense foliage shades the soil, minimizing weed growth.

3. Buckwheat

Buckwheat grows quickly and forms a canopy that shades out weeds. Its rapid growth cycle allows it to be used as a cover crop, providing a temporary but effective weed barrier.

4. Alfalfa

Alfalfa has a deep root system that competes effectively with weeds for nutrients and water. It also improves soil structure, benefiting surrounding plants.

Practical Examples of Companion Planting

Example 1: Tomatoes and Basil

Tomatoes and basil make excellent companions. Basil’s dense foliage shades the soil, reducing weed growth, while its roots help repel pests that can harm tomatoes.

Example 2: Corn, Beans, and Squash

Known as the "Three Sisters," this trio works together to suppress weeds. Corn provides a structure for beans to climb, beans fix nitrogen, and squash’s broad leaves shade the ground.

What Is Allelopathy in Companion Planting?

Allelopathy is a biological phenomenon where plants release chemicals through their roots or leaves that inhibit the growth of nearby plants, including weeds. This natural herbicidal effect can be advantageous in companion planting.

Can Companion Planting Replace Herbicides?

While companion planting can significantly reduce weed pressure, it may not completely replace herbicides in all situations. It is most effective as part of an integrated pest management strategy that combines multiple approaches.
